Commenting on Ezekiel 38:1-13
Gog will boast to his counselors and confederates of an easy conquest: a land of undefended villages, people at rest and unsuspecting, dwelling in perfect security without walls or gates. He mistakes their peace for weakness and their trust in God's protection for vulnerability.
